On this day in 1992, in Achrafieh, Nadim Abdel Nour was carrying his young son during a quiet family moment when gunmen of the Syrian occupation surrounded him.
He knew escape was impossible, and that any resistance could turn the street into blood-perhaps beginning with his own child.
So he let his five-year-old son go, and with a father's final courage, said :
"If you want to kill me, kill me... but not in front of my son."
Then he whispered:
"Run, son."
The child stepped away...
And Nadim was struck down by the bullets of that same ruthless security regime.
